Since KFD no longer registers its own callbacks for SDMA resets, and only KGD uses the reset mechanism,
we can simplify the SDMA reset flow by directly calling the ring's `stop_queue` and `start_queue` functions.
This patch removes the dynamic callback mechanism and prepares for its eventual deprecation.

1. **Remove Dynamic Callbacks**:
   - The `pre_reset` and `post_reset` callback invocations in `amdgpu_sdma_reset_engine` are removed.
   - Instead, the ring's `stop_queue` and `start_queue` functions are called directly during the reset process.

2. **Prepare for Deprecation of Dynamic Mechanism**:
   - By removing the callback invocations, this patch prepares the codebase for the eventual removal of the dynamic callback registration mechanism.

v2: Update stop_queue/start_queue function paramters to use ring pointer instead of device/instance(Christian)

---
 drivers/gpu/drm/amd/amdgpu/amdgpu_ring.h |  2 ++
 drivers/gpu/drm/amd/amdgpu/amdgpu_sdma.c | 34 +++---------------------
 drivers/gpu/drm/amd/amdgpu/sdma_v4_4_2.c | 13 ++++-----
 3 files changed, 13 insertions(+), 36 deletions(-)

di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_ring.h b/drivers/gpu/drm/amd/amdgpu/amdgpu_ring.h
index 615c3d5c5a8d..23ea221e26de 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_ring.h
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_ring.h
@@ -237,6 +237,8 @@ struct amdgpu_ring_funcs {
 	void (*patch_ce)(struct amdgpu_ring *ring, unsigned offset);
 	void (*patch_de)(struct amdgpu_ring *ring, unsigned offset);
 	int (*reset)(struct amdgpu_ring *ring, unsigned int vmid);
+	int (*stop_queue)(struct amdgpu_ring *ring);
+	int (*start_queue)(struct amdgpu_ring *ring);
 	void (*emit_cleaner_shader)(struct amdgpu_ring *ring);
 	bool (*is_guilty)(struct amdgpu_ring *ring);
 };
di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_sdma.c b/drivers/gpu/drm/amd/amdgpu/amdgpu_sdma.c
index 0a9893fee828..b51fe644940f 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_sdma.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_sdma.c
@@ -558,16 +558,10 @@ void amdgpu_sdma_register_on_reset_callbacks(struct amdgpu_device *adev, struct
  * @adev: Pointer to the AMDGPU device
  * @instance_id: ID of the SDMA engine instance to reset
  *
- * This function performs the following steps:
- * 1. Calls all registered pre_reset callbacks to allow KFD and AMDGPU to save their state.
- * 2. Resets the specified SDMA engine instance.
- * 3. Calls all registered post_reset callbacks to allow KFD and AMDGPU to restore their state.
- *
  * Returns: 0 on success, or a negative error code on failure.
  */
 int amdgpu_sdma_reset_engine(struct amdgpu_device *adev, uint32_t instance_id)
 {
-	struct sdma_on_reset_funcs *funcs;
 	int ret = 0;
 	struct amdgpu_sdma_instance *sdma_instance = &adev->sdma.instance[instance_id];
 	struct amdgpu_ring *gfx_ring = &sdma_instance->ring;
@@ -589,18 +583,8 @@ int amdgpu_sdma_reset_engine(struct amdgpu_device *adev, uint32_t instance_id)
 		page_sched_stopped = true;
 	}
 
-	/* Invoke all registered pre_reset callbacks */
-	list_for_each_entry(funcs, &adev->sdma.reset_callback_list, list) {
-		if (funcs->pre_reset) {
-			ret = funcs->pre_reset(adev, instance_id);
-			if (ret) {
-				dev_err(adev->dev,
-				"beforeReset callback failed for instance %u: %d\n",
-					instance_id, ret);
-				goto exit;
-			}
-		}
-	}
+	if (gfx_ring->funcs->stop_queue)
+		gfx_ring->funcs->stop_queue(gfx_ring);
 
 	/* Perform the SDMA reset for the specified instance */
 	ret = amdgpu_dpm_reset_sdma(adev, 1 << instance_id);
@@ -609,18 +593,8 @@ int amdgpu_sdma_reset_engine(struct amdgpu_device *adev, uint32_t instance_id)
 		goto exit;
 	}
 
-	/* Invoke all registered post_reset callbacks */
-	list_for_each_entry(funcs, &adev->sdma.reset_callback_list, list) {
-		if (funcs->post_reset) {
-			ret = funcs->post_reset(adev, instance_id);
-			if (ret) {
-				dev_err(adev->dev,
-				"afterReset callback failed for instance %u: %d\n",
-					instance_id, ret);
-				goto exit;
-			}
-		}
-	}
+	if (gfx_ring->funcs->start_queue)
+		gfx_ring->funcs->start_queue(gfx_ring);
 
 exit:
 	/* Restart the scheduler's work queue for the GFX and page rings
diff --git a/drivers/gpu/drm/amd/amdgpu/sdma_v4_4_2.c b/drivers/gpu/drm/amd/amdgpu/sdma_v4_4_2.c
index 688a720bbbbd..a8330504692d 100644
--- a/drivers/gpu/drm/amd/amdgpu/sdma_v4_4_2.c
+++ b/drivers/gpu/drm/amd/amdgpu/sdma_v4_4_2.c
@@ -1678,11 +1678,12 @@ static int sdma_v4_4_2_reset_queue(struct amdgpu_ring *ring, unsigned int vmid)
 	return r;
 }
 
-static int sdma_v4_4_2_stop_queue(struct amdgpu_device *adev, uint32_t instance_id)
+static int sdma_v4_4_2_stop_queue(struct amdgpu_ring *ring)
 {
 	u32 inst_mask;
 	uint64_t rptr;
-	struct amdgpu_ring *ring = &adev->sdma.instance[instance_id].ring;
+	struct amdgpu_device *adev = ring->adev;
+	u32 instance_id = GET_INST(SDMA0, ring->me);
 
 	if (amdgpu_sriov_vf(adev))
 		return -EINVAL;
@@ -1715,11 +1716,11 @@ static int sdma_v4_4_2_stop_queue(struct amdgpu_device *adev, uint32_t instance_
 	return 0;
 }
 
-static int sdma_v4_4_2_restore_queue(struct amdgpu_device *adev, uint32_t instance_id)
+static int sdma_v4_4_2_restore_queue(struct amdgpu_ring *ring)
 {
 	int i;
 	u32 inst_mask;
-	struct amdgpu_ring *ring = &adev->sdma.instance[instance_id].ring;
+	struct amdgpu_device *adev = ring->adev;
 
 	inst_mask = 1 << ring->me;
 	udelay(50);
@@ -1740,8 +1741,6 @@ static int sdma_v4_4_2_restore_queue(struct amdgpu_device *adev, uint32_t instan
 }
 
 static struct sdma_on_reset_funcs sdma_v4_4_2_engine_reset_funcs = {
-	.pre_reset = sdma_v4_4_2_stop_queue,
-	.post_reset = sdma_v4_4_2_restore_queue,
 };
 
 static void sdma_v4_4_2_set_engine_reset_funcs(struct amdgpu_device *adev)
@@ -2143,6 +2142,8 @@ static const struct amdgpu_ring_funcs sdma_v4_4_2_ring_funcs = {
 	.emit_reg_wait = sdma_v4_4_2_ring_emit_reg_wait,
 	.emit_reg_write_reg_wait = amdgpu_ring_emit_reg_write_reg_wait_helper,
 	.reset = sdma_v4_4_2_reset_queue,
+	.stop_queue = sdma_v4_4_2_stop_queue,
+	.start_queue = sdma_v4_4_2_restore_queue,
 	.is_guilty = sdma_v4_4_2_ring_is_guilty,
 };
